Stargate Universe: Aftermath

By | October 10, 2010

I didn’t like this episode.  Rush is quite literally going insane.  He’s hallucinating, and he knows it, but he still thinks he’s a better candidate to lead the expedition than Col. Young.  It doesn’t feel very realistic.  It also doesn’t seem likely that he would actually keep to himself the information he is keeping to himself.  It’s extremely selfish and can only be harmful to the others.  He’s also pretty fanatical about Destiny having some as yet undiscovered purpose, and that’s kind of grating.

The business with Riley was pretty sad, and serves to drive Col. Young even deeper into the dark place he’s hiding in.  He’s going to snap one of these days.

In the previews for the next episode, they appear to have located the ship that was going through and seeding planets with Stargates.  It seems kind of convenient that they got to Destiny as it was nearing the seed ship…
